Gretel Killeen is an Australian author, newspaper columnist, and TV personality who is famous for hosting the Australian reality television series, Big Brother.

In between Big Brother commitments, Killeen is also working as a successful freelance writer and author, an ambassador for UNICEF and can also be heard on Sydney and Melbourne radio stations.

Killeen was born in 1963 in Turramurra, a suburb of Sydney. After dropping out of her law studies course, she returned to Sydney and studied communications. She also tried her hand at performing stand up comedy, something she continued for a few years. Killeen later moved into comedy writing, which quickly expanded to cover print and television, and also appeared as a regular panelist on Beauty and the Beast, an Australian TV panel advice and discussion show.

Big Brother

Killeen's career break came when she was asked to host the Australian edition of Big Brother. Killeen has hosted other special events including the televised Australia Day-eve celebrations on 25 January, 2006.

In 2002, Big Brother viewers watched on as Killeen slipped on the stairs in the Big Brother House, falling and breaking her umbrella. A number of housemates rushed to her aid, but Killeen suffered nothing more than a bruised ego.

Killeen also tripped as she ushered the very first evictee from the first series of Australian Big Brother (2001), the wannabe-dominatrix Andy, down the dark, smokey and mirrored corridor leading to the stage on her eviction night. In fact, Killeen cut the top of her finger open as she reached for a handhold on the mirrored wall, and reportedly sat through the rest of the show with her hand out of the camera's view, her fingertip hanging loose. When the show ended, she was rushed to hospital and the top of her finger was sewn back on.

Notably, Killeen was spotted several times in public with Big Brother series 3 (2003) contestant Daniel 'Saxon' Small. This led to intense media speculation the two were romantically involved. They have since split up.
